Mohamad Madhoun

Partner - TMT
Mohamad Madhoun is a Partner in Consulting who is focused on Technology, Media and Telecom (TMT), as well as Information and
Communications Technology (ICT) sectors. Based out of Qatar, serving the GCC region as a whole, and Qatar market specifically.

Mohamad possesses more than 25 years of industry experience within TMT and ICT, where he held various senior executive positions at
multiple regional operators across the GCC. Mohamad also spent 12 years working at a telecom equipment manufacturer.

Mohamad has 16 years of industry experience in Qatar and working on infrastructure and technology projects. He has spent his time focused
on strategy development and execution on a national scale. He has also delivered operational excellence and efficiency projects maximizing
the value from capital expenditure on mega projects.

Hassan Malik
Partner – Sports & Tourism
Hassan Malik is a Partner at Monitor Deloitte in the Middle East with over 15 years’ international experience in strategy and execution
through consulting and industry roles. Hassan has significant experience in Corporate and Business Unit Strategy, Strategic Planning,
Strategy Execution and Economic Development.

Prior to Monitor Deloitte, Hassan led the Strategy Development team at Etihad Airways for over 3 years and prior to this Hassan was a
Strategy Consultant with L.E.K. Consulting in London advising large corporations and Private Equity companies on strategic issues and
commercial due diligence. Hassan holds an MA in Economics and Management from the University of Oxford, UK.

Mauro Gianni
Manager - TMT
Mauro is a Manager at Monitor Deloitte since 2021 based in the Dubai office. Mauro brings 7+ years of strategy consulting experience across
the Middle East, Europe and Japan.

His focus areas include Corporate Strategy Design, Business Planning and Target Operating Model, having supported a variety of Clients
mainly across the Entertainment, Media, and Technology sectors.
Mauro has gained broad exposure in developing go-to-market strategies, business plans and feasibility studies of ventures featuring
innovative solutions and value propositions.

Mauro holds a MSc in Finance from LUISS University, Rome and a BSc in Business Administration from RomaTre University, Rome. He is an
Italian native speaker and is fluent in English and Spanish.

Faisal Abdulla Khalid Al Mana
Al Jassra Group Chairman
Faisal is a Qatari businessman who collectively co-owns more than 16 companies working across a great variety of industries in Qatar. He is
currently the Chairman of Al Jassra Group and its affiliated companies and the Vice-Chairman of Redco Construction Al Mana group of
companies. He is the founder of The Maintainers one of the leading Facility Management company in Qatar servicing more than 30 different
industries. He is a dynamic businessman with exceptional leadership talents, and a sharp vision fulfilling his loyalty and patriotism for his
country. He is presently Board Member at Al Khaliji Bank and has previously had various roles at governmental entities to name a few;
Director of Project Development Department at Qatar Development Bank as well as Director of Minister’s office at the Qatar Ministry of
Economy & Commerce. Faisal holds a Bachelor of economics from Qatar University and Trade policy diploma from the World Trade
Organization (WTO).
